  • The internal rotenone-insensitive NADPH dehydrogenase contributes to malate oxidation by potato tuber and pea leaf mitochondria

    • Inside-out submitochondrial particles from both potato (Solanum tuberosum L. cv. Bintje) tubers and pea (Pisum sativum L. cv. Oregon) leaves possess three distinct dehydrogenase activities: Complex I catalyzes the rotenone-sensitive oxidation of deamino-NADH, NDin(NADPH) catalyzes the rotenone-insensitive and Ca2+-dependent oxidation of NADPH and NDin(NADH) catalyzes the rotenone-insensitive and Ca2+-independent oxidation of NADH. Diphenylene iodonium (DPI) inhibits complex I, NDin(NADPH) and NDin (NADH) activity with a Ki of 3.7, 0.17 and 63 µM, respectively, and the 400-fold difference in Ki between the two NDin made possible the use of DPI inhibition to estimate NDin (NADPH) contribution to malate oxidation by intact mitochondria. The oxidation of malate in the presence of rotenone by intact mitochondria from both species was inhibited by 5 µM DPI. The maximum decrease in rate was 10–20 nmol O2 mg-1 min-1. The reduction level of NAD(P) was manipulated by measuring malate oxidation in state 3 at pH 7.2 and 6.8 and in the presence and absence of an oxaloacetate-removing system. The inhibition by DPI was largest under conditions of high NAD(P) reduction. Control experiments showed that 125 µM DPI had no effect on the activities of malate dehydrogenase (with NADH or NADPH) or malic enzyme (with NAD+ or NADP+) in a matrix extract from either species. Malate dehydrogenase was unable to use NADP+ in the forward reaction. DPI at 125 µM did not have any effect on succinate oxidation by intact mitochondria of either species. We conclude that the inhibition caused by DPI in the presence of rotenone in plant mitochondria oxidizing malate is due to inhibition of NDin(NADPH) oxidizing NADPH. Thus, NADP turnover contributes to malate oxidation by plant mitochondria.

  • Stroke in geriatric patients - Aspects of depression, cognition and motor activity

    • Six depression rating scales, GDS, Zung, CES-D, CPRS-D and Cornell, were compared in 40 patients. The validity was good for all scales except for the Cornell scale. A comprehensive investigation was done in 116 elderly stroke patients. There was no difference in prevalence and severity of post-stroke depression in relation to side of lesion. A test for receptive aphasia, the Token test, showed that 75% of patients with left hemisphere lesion and aphasia, 36% of patients with right hemisphere lesion and 5% of controls had abnormal test initially. The relationships and sensitivity of different visuo-spatial neglect tests were examined. Sensitivity was around 50% for the best tests. Neglect patients showed a greater cognitive dysfunction initially and a slower recovery. The validity of a cognitive test, the MMSE, was examined. Five neuropsychological tests were used as a subgroup of patients.MMSE scores were significant lower for the patients than for the controls. The sensitivity of the MMSE was 56%, the specificity 80% and the false negative ratio 39% against the neuropsychological tests. Motor activity after stroke was assessed by parts of the Fugl-Meyer test in different infarction subgroups and initial severity groups. The initial severity groups were better predictors for outcome. Multiple regression showed three variables to be predictors: initial motor activity, Barthel Index and right hemisphere lesion.

  • Atmospheric transport of persistent organic pollutants to aquatic ecosystems

    • The load of persistent organic pollutants (POPs) is considered high in the Baltic ecosystem. The Baltic Sea spans over 12 latitudes and the regional differences in climate affect the behavior of POPs. Therefore spatial and temporal variability of the concentrations of POPs in air and precipitation within this area has been investgated at 16 (mostly rural) stations around the Baltic Sea between 1990-1993. In addition, the deposition of gaseous and particulate associated POPs to the Baltic Sea is estimated from empirical data. This atmospheric input of POPs is compared with the input from rivers. Additionally, data from Ross Island, Antarctica and Lake Kariba, Zimbabwe, Africa is presented, and all results are discussed and explained using the ”global fractionation hypothesis” as a framework. In the Baltic Sea, concentrations of individual POPs in air were found to be influenced by their physical-chemical properties, ambient air temperature and location. A latitudinal gradient, with higher levels in the south was found for PCBs and the gradient was more pronounced for the low volatility congeners. As a result, the high volatility congeners in air increased in relative importance with latitude. Generally, PCB concentrations increased with temperature, but slopes of the partial pressure in air versus reciprocal temperature were different between congeners and between stations. In general, the low volatility congeners were more temperature dependent than the high volatility PCB congeners. Steep slopes at a sampling location indicate that the concentration in air is largely determined by diffusive exchange with soils. Lack of a temperature dependence may be due to the influence of long-range transported air masses at remote sites and due to the episodic, or random nature of PCB sources at urban sites. The concentrations of individual congeners in precipitation were found to be influenced by atmospheric concentrations of PCBs, ambient temperature, precipitation volume and the compounds physical-chemical properties. Concentrations of PCBs in precipitation decreased with temperature, and the slopes of this relationship were the same for all stations but differed between congeners. High volatility congeners showed steeper slopes for the temperature relationship than did low volatility PCB congeners. Annual wash out ratios were calculated and found to decrease with congener volatility. Wash out ratios generally decreased with temperature. At snow scavenging events the wash out ratio of PCBs increased with a factor of 2. Latitudinal trends for PCB concentrations in precipitation and for deposition were not statistically significant, but tended to be higher in the south for low volatility congeners. For high volatility congeners the latitudinal trend was reversed. Deposition of PCB congeners varied seasonally, with a factor between 2.0-3.2, and was generally highest during fall. The calculated yearly deposition of PCBs to the Baltic Sea was 387 kg and 5-18 kg for individual congeners, with PCB-138 having the highest flux.

  • Evidence of Latitudinal Fractionation of Polychlorinated Biphenyl Congeners along the Baltic Sea Region

    • Annual cycles of the atmospheric concentrations of PCBs were determined at 16 (mostly rural) stations around the Baltic Sea between 1990 and 1993. The concentration levels of individual congeners were found to be influenced by their physical-chemical properties, ambient temperature, and geographical location. Median levels of PCBs were similar at all stations except at one urban site near Riga. A latitudinal gradient with higher levels in the south was found for the sum of PCB as well as for individual congeners, and the gradient was more pronounced for the low volatility congeners. As a result, the high volatility congeners increased in relative importance with latitude. Generally, PCB concentrations increased with temperature, but slopes of the partial pressure in air versus reciprocal temperature were different between congeners and between stations. In general, the low volatility congeners were more temperature dependent than the high volatility PCB congeners. Steep slopes at a sampling location indicate that the concentration in air is largely determined by diffusive exchange with soils. Lack of a temperature dependence may be due to the influence of long-range transported air masses at remote sites and due to the episodic or random nature of PCB sources at urban sites.

  • Model representation of sand tests

    • A non-associated plasticity model for friction materials was presented by Krenk (1999) and an efficient calibration procedure developed by Ahadi & Krenk (1999). The ability of the model to represent the behaviour of sand was verified by calibrating the model from different sets of triaxial drained tests for both loose and dense sand performed at different confining pressures. This paper is a collection of calibration and prediction examples. The model was calibrated according to the procedure described in Ahadi & Krenk (1999) and results were compared to experimental data from Borup & Hedegaard (1995) and Ibsen & Jakobssen (1996). The obtained material parameters indicate that the shear modulus $G$ should increase with the mean stress, while the increase of the bulk stiffness should be less than linear. The dependency on mean stress is studied by fitting a power law function for both $G$ and $kappa$. Finally prediction for undrained (constant volume) test at different initial pressures are presented with material parameter determined from drained triaxial test data.

  • Non-associated plasticity for soils

    • A brief overview is given of a non-associated plasticity theory developed for soils based on the concept of a characteristic stress state of vanishing incremental dilation, and a calibration procedure using only test data from a standard triaxial test. The capability of the model is illustrated by calibration examples and predictions made for standard triaxial tests at different confining stress levels and constant volume tests on sand. The model is found to predict stress-strain behaviour and development of volumetric strain well.
